Transaction 4b63330d23a47613a45f1b5f61bcc64df2090ad5edbb956c1565cb03f8e08228
1 Input
-
80d681f751ea01ca9da60917d50c5c80f117a01c822970f17e839315e0d7d51a:0
OP_DATA_48(48) 44022033aa0d5bb92d01736faced8dd5c0f76b0fbe33662fde9649ad8a5064d9d4a47f022072e3eced8878a079bc4da9
1 Outputs
- 4b63330d23a47613a45f1b5f61bcc64df2090ad5edbb956c1565cb03f8e08228:0
value 557576
address 3DFhyxFM3qhhnKXKXwKtioHKhY72y4MWBt